Safety First: Choosing a TV Enclosure Safe From Ligatures
When selecting a television enclosure, it's crucial to consider safety, particularly against the risk of ligature. Ligatures are strong cords or objects that can be used for unsafe purposes. A secure enclosure will have features like sturdy construction and minimized gaps or holes where ligatures could be secured. Additionally, look for enclosures made from solid materials that are difficult to modify with ligatures.

Safeguarding Patients and Guests: Ligature-Resistant TV Solutions
In today's clinical facilities, the wellbeing of patients and guests is paramount. While TVs offer valuable entertainment and information, they can also present a possible risk if not properly secured. Ligature-resistant TV solutions are engineered to minimize this hazard by reducing accessible wires that could be used for self-harm. These innovative systems incorporate durable construction and integrated wiring to create a secure viewing environment.
